
Payroll Specialist
Ace Parking, San Diego, CA, United States
The Payroll Specialist serves as the strategic and operational partner to the Director of Payroll, providing advanced technical, compliance, and analytical support. This project-focused role is designed for a highly self‑directed professional who thrives with minimal supervision and concentrates on system optimization, regulatory compliance, and payroll accuracy. The position plays a critical role in supporting the implementation and maintenance of UKG Dimensions/WFM Pro, ensuring tax and labor law compliance across multiple jurisdictions, and strengthening internal controls through auditing and reporting. The role requires deep expertise in payroll systems configuration, multi‑state tax reconciliation, and labor law interpretation—particularly California regulations. Acting as a key resource for high‑level initiatives, the analyst manages complex system mapping for union contracts and statutory requirements, conducts audits using UKG Business Intelligence, oversees GL reporting and posting, and provides leadership continuity as the Director’s primary backup. Additionally, the position proactively monitors legislative updates, translating new payroll laws into system adjustments to maintain ongoing compliance and operational efficiency. This is a project‑heavy role for a self‑starter who works well with minimal supervision.
Key Responsibilities:
Manage 'behind the scenes' mapping for union contracts (CBAs) and state laws; set up and test accrual rules and timekeeping configurations.
Assist with the transition to UKG Dimensions/WFM Pro; help with system setup, data testing, and troubleshooting to ensure a smooth 'go-live'.
Perform regular multi‑state tax reconciliations; assist with year‑end W‑2 processing and tax audits.
Use UKG Business Intelligence to audit tip reporting, PTO accruals, and minimum wage compliance.
Manage GL reporting and posting; act as the Director’s primary backup for high‑level projects and department coverage.
Ensure compliance with California and multi‑state requirements, including weighted average overtime and meal premiums.
Research new payroll laws and update system settings to keep the company compliant without daily reminders.
Qualifications:
Bachelor’s degree preferred.
3–5 years of payroll experience, ideally in a large‑scale environment (5,000+ employees).
Must have UKG Pro experience.
Background in payroll tax reconciliation and mapping CBAs into payroll software.
Experience with GL reporting and journal entries is a plus.
Self‑starter capable of hitting project deadlines with very little oversight.
